Lon Lee
Hong Kong-born, London-based, Lon Lee works in oil and mixed media. Her paintings explore impermanence and transformation, layering texture, light and symbolism to invite quiet reflection and discovery.

Fynn Klün
German-born, Marseille-based, Fynn Klün works in acrylic, epoxy resin, and found objects on canvas. His pieces combine organic and geometric forms, shifting with light to create moments of curiosity and gentle play.
